The Western diet is dominated by foods lacking in nutrients from "summary" of The Dorito Effect by Mark Schatzker

In the Western world, our diet has strayed far from what our bodies truly need. We no longer prioritize nutrient-dense foods that provide us with essential vitamins and minerals. Instead, our grocery store shelves are filled with highly processed foods that are engineered to be hyper-palatable but lack the nutrients our bodies crave. Walk down the aisles of any supermarket, and you'll be bombarded with a plethora of options that are high in calories but low in actual nutritional value. These foods may taste good in the moment, but they do little to nourish our bodies and keep us healthy in the long run. We have become accustomed to reaching for convenience foods that are quick and easy to prepare, without considering the impact they have on our overall health. The rise of fast food and processed snacks has only exacerbated this issue. Foods like burgers, fries, and sugary drinks may be satisfying in the moment, but they do little to support our health and well-being. We've become hooked on the intense flavors and textures of these foods, without realizing that they are essentially empty calories that do little to fuel our bodies. As a result, many people in the Western world are overfed but undernourished. We consume plenty of calories, but we are lacking in the essential nutrients our bodies need to function properly. This imbalance can lead to a host of health issues, including obesity, diabetes, and heart disease. It's time for us to rethink our approach to food and prioritize nutrient-dense options that will truly nourish our bodies. By focusing on whole, unprocessed foods that are rich in vitamins, minerals, and other essential nutrients, we can support our health and well-being in a meaningful way. Let's break free from the cycle of empty calories and start nourishing our bodies with the nutrients they truly need.
